#1ce54c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1ce54c is composed of 11% red, 89.8% green and 29.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 66.8%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 134.3 degrees, a saturation of 79.4% and a lightness of 50.4%. #1ce54c color hex could be obtained by blending #38ff98 with #00cb00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

Shades and Tints of #1ce54c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000201 is the darkest color, while #effdf3 is the lightest one.
